Bone stock aside from a Polestar tune which brings the regular T6 up to R-design spec. It's the same tune that's on the R-design, so it's like a 100% stock S60 R-design, only less sporty.

I did add two gallons of race gas for my last runs. My first bunch of runs was on 93 octane and I got 13.9s and a 13.8 at 100. After a cool down period and two gallons of 109, my next time was a 13.6 at 101, and my ETs continued to drop/ traps rose to 103 over the course of the next runs. I'm not sure how much of this was attributable to the race gas, or to cooler temps later in the evening but the car did feel quite a bit stronger as the night went on and the ECU adapted to all the pulls.

My 13.4 was on my last run before they closed the track. It was still 70 degrees out, so I'm wondering if it might have 13.2s in it when I run in ~50 degree air at the end of the season...

Practice is hugely important. There are so many subtle details involved with drag racing and optimizing your existing setup before modifications come into play. Right now you're about 1 second off what that car can run, bone stock, long-throw shifter notwithstanding. I used to routinely beat heavily modified New Edge Mustangs when my 2002 GT was completely stock, often running a full second quicker because I was really systematic about playing around with launch rpm, clutch takeup technique, shift points, cool down periods, tire pressure, etc. etc.

I've already done the expect magazine numbers and then come out horribly disappointed with the 9-2x, and then after a half a dozen runs I got closer to what I expected.  I only had 3 runs on my VF setup and the 13.6@100 was the only run that felt good, the rest bogged like crazy.

If I get into the 14s I will be happy, I've seen the best results with people launching around 3k rpms and shifting around 6k.  Gotta minimize the wheel hop, not used to actually having torque, the 9-2x would bog with anything below 4.5k.
